DNS Settings and Management for .ENTERPRISES Domains
DNS settings act as the backbone that connects a domain name to its hosting infrastructure. Accurate configuration ensures that visitors and systems reach the correct destination without delays or errors. Essential DNS records, such as A, AAAA, CNAME, MX, and TXT, must be properly configured to support websites, enterprise email systems, and service integrations. Even small errors can lead to downtime or service disruptions, making careful management critical. Regular monitoring and updates help maintain consistent performance and prevent unexpected issues.
Efficient DNS management also involves selecting high-performance name servers and optimizing TTL values based on operational needs. Lower TTL values allow quicker updates during infrastructure changes, while higher values improve stability during normal operations. Advanced features such as DNS failover, load balancing, and redundancy improve reliability. Keeping DNS records organized and documented simplifies troubleshooting and ensures long-term consistency.
Security Features for .ENTERPRISES Domains
Security is a critical component of managing a .ENTERPRISES domain, especially when handling large-scale operations and sensitive data. DNSSEC helps verify the authenticity of DNS responses, reducing the risk of malicious redirection or spoofing attacks. Domain locking adds an extra layer of protection by preventing unauthorized transfers or modifications. These features help safeguard the domain from hijacking and misuse.
Additional protection includes SSL or TLS certificates, which encrypt communication between users and enterprise systems, ensuring data privacy. Regular monitoring for unusual activity, along with strong authentication practices, further strengthens security. Keeping all security measures up to date and aligned with best practices helps create a secure environment that supports trust and operational stability.

What happens if you forget to renew your .ENTERPRISES domain?
When a .ENTERPRISES domain is not renewed before its expiration date, it does not get deleted immediately. Instead, it becomes inactive, which means the website, email, and any connected services may stop working. This can interrupt operations, affect communication, and reduce trust if the domain is linked to a business or enterprise platform.
After expiration, the domain usually enters a recovery period where renewal is still possible. If no action is taken during this phase, it may move into a stricter redemption stage. Eventually, the domain can be released for public registration, allowing someone else to claim it.
Is there a grace period after .ENTERPRISES domain expiration?
Yes, most .ENTERPRISES domains include a grace period after expiration. During this time, the domain remains inactive but can still be renewed without complicated procedures. This gives enough time to restore services and maintain ownership.
The length of the grace period depends on the registrar’s policies. Acting within this timeframe helps avoid additional complications. Missing this window may lead to a more restrictive recovery phase.

What is .ENTERPRISES domain name transfer?
A .ENTERPRISES domain name transfer is the process of moving a domain from one registrar to another. This is often done to access better services, improved support, or more efficient management tools.
The transfer does not change ownership of the domain. It only changes the registrar responsible for managing it. Once completed, all settings are handled through the new provider.
When should you transfer your .ENTERPRISES domain to another registrar?
Transferring a .ENTERPRISES domain is useful when the current registrar does not meet expectations. This may include limited features, poor support, or difficulty managing domain settings.
It is also beneficial to consolidate multiple domains under a single provider. Planning the transfer before expiration helps ensure a smooth and uninterrupted process.
How do you transfer a .ENTERPRISES domain name?
To transfer a .ENTERPRISES domain, it must first be unlocked with the current registrar. An authorization code is then requested to verify ownership and initiate the transfer process.
The code is submitted to the new registrar, followed by verification. Approval is usually completed through email confirmation. Once approved, the domain is successfully transferred.
How long does .ENTERPRISES domain transfer takes?
The transfer process for a .ENTERPRISES domain typically takes a few days to complete. The timeline depends on how quickly verification steps are completed and how both registrars handle the request.
Responding promptly to confirmation emails helps speed up the process. In most cases, transfers are completed within a standard timeframe without delays.
Is there any downtime during .ENTERPRISES domain transfer?
In most cases, there is no downtime during a .ENTERPRISES domain transfer. The domain continues to function normally as long as DNS settings remain unchanged.
However, if DNS configurations are modified during the transfer, temporary disruptions may occur. Keeping DNS records consistent ensures uninterrupted access to services.
What are the requirements for transferring .ENTERPRISES domain?
To transfer a .ENTERPRISES domain, certain conditions must be met. The domain should be unlocked, and a valid authorization code must be obtained. It should also not be recently registered or transferred.
Accurate contact information is required for verification during the process. Meeting all requirements beforehand helps ensure a smooth and successful transfer.
Does transferring .ENTERPRISES domain extend its validity?
Yes, transferring a .ENTERPRISES domain often extends its registration period. Once the transfer is completed, an additional validity period is usually added.
This extension helps maintain continuity and reduces the risk of expiration during the transfer. It also provides added value by combining transfer and renewal benefits.
Is there a cost to transfer .ENTERPRISES domain?
Yes, transferring a .ENTERPRISES domain typically involves a fee charged by the new registrar. The cost may vary depending on the provider and the services included.
In many cases, the transfer fee includes an extension of the domain’s registration period. Reviewing the details beforehand helps ensure clarity and avoid unexpected terms.

How can I protect my .ENTERPRISES domain from hijacking or misuse?
Protecting a .ENTERPRISES domain starts with securing the registrar account. Using a strong password and enabling two-factor authentication significantly reduces the risk of unauthorized access. Regular monitoring helps detect unusual activity early.
Enabling domain lock features adds another layer of security. A locked domain prevents unauthorized transfers or changes. Keeping contact information up to date ensures you receive important alerts.
Do I need hosting to use .ENTERPRISES domain?
A .ENTERPRISES domain can be registered without hosting. It acts as an online address that can be reserved for future use, giving flexibility when planning a website.
However, hosting is required for the domain to function as a website. Hosting provides the infrastructure needed to store and display content. Without hosting, the domain will not show any active site.
Can I buy .ENTERPRISES domain without hosting?
A .ENTERPRISES domain can be purchased independently without hosting. This is useful for securing a domain name early, especially for business or branding purposes.
Buying a domain separately gives you the flexibility to choose a hosting provider later. Once ready, the domain can be easily connected via DNS configuration.
Can I use my .ENTERPRISES domain with any hosting provider?
A .ENTERPRISES domain is compatible with most hosting providers that support standard DNS management. This allows freedom to choose hosting based on performance and pricing.
Proper DNS configuration ensures a smooth connection between the domain and the hosting server. This also makes it easier to switch providers if needed.
How do I point my .ENTERPRISES domain to my hosting server?
Pointing a .ENTERPRISES domain to a hosting server involves updating DNS settings in the domain control panel. The most common method is changing the nameservers to those provided by the hosting provider.
Another option is manually configuring DNS records, such as A records or CNAME records. This offers more control over domain behavior. DNS changes may take time to apply fully.
Can I use .ENTERPRISES domain only for email services?
A .ENTERPRISES domain can be used exclusively for email services without hosting a website. This is done by setting up MX records to connect the domain with an email provider. Using a custom domain for email improves professionalism and credibility. It helps create a strong communication identity.

What is the minimum and maximum length of .ENTERPRISES domain?
A .ENTERPRISES domain follows standard domain naming rules. The main domain label usually allows a minimum of 2 characters and a maximum of 63 characters. Choosing the right length improves usability. Short and clear names are easier to remember and more effective.
Can .ENTERPRISES domain contain numbers or hyphens?
A .ENTERPRISES domain can include numbers and hyphens, offering flexibility when creating a unique domain name. This is useful when preferred names are already taken. However, excessive use can reduce readability. A clean and simple domain name is generally more effective for branding.
Are there any restrictions on .ENTERPRISES domain names?
Yes, .ENTERPRISES domains follow general registration rules. These include restrictions on the use of illegal, misleading, or trademarked names. Following these guidelines ensures smooth registration. Choosing a compliant name helps avoid disputes or suspension.
Can I change my .ENTERPRISES domain name after registration?
Once a .ENTERPRISES domain is registered, the name itself cannot be changed. Domain systems do not allow editing the registered name. Other settings, such as DNS and contact details, can be updated at any time. This allows flexibility in managing the domain.
Can I sell or transfer ownership of my .ENTERPRISES domain?
A .ENTERPRISES domain can be sold or transferred through the registrar. The process includes verification steps to ensure secure ownership transfer. Before transferring, the domain should be unlocked and eligible for transfer. Proper authorization ensures a smooth process.
